2 Simple Facts About Simulate Different Processes Explained

De Wikifliping

Within the realm of computing, simulating independent computer processes stands as a cornerstone technique that permits efficient multitasking, enhanced performance, and optimized resource utilization. By replicating multiple independent processes in a computing environment, developers, engineers, and users can achieve various objectives ranging from workload distribution to system scalability. This article delves into the advantages, applications, and best practices linked to simulating independent computer processes, shedding light on its significance in modern computing paradigms.

Understanding Independent Computer Processes
Independent computer processes refer to distinct operations or tasks executed in a computing environment without interdependence or sequential execution constraints. By simulating independent processes, developers can leverage parallelism, concurrency, and distributed computing principles to enhance system performance, responsiveness, and scalability. Whether it's data processing, computational tasks, or system operations, simulating independent processes enables efficient resource allocation, workload distribution, and task management within complex computing ecosystems.

Advantages of Simulating Independent Processes
Simulating independent computer processes offers a number of advantages, fostering efficiency, performance, and scalability within diverse computing environments. Firstly, by leveraging parallelism and concurrency, developers can accelerate task execution, reduce latency, and optimize system throughput, thereby enhancing user experience, responsiveness, and productivity. At the same, time, simulating independent processes facilitates efficient resource utilization, enabling optimal allocation of CPU, memory, storage, and Fingerprint Browser Network resources to diverse tasks, applications, and services. Furthermore, by isolating and managing independent processes, developers can enhance system reliability, fault tolerance, and resilience, ensuring continuous operation, data integrity, and service availability in dynamic computing environments.

Applications of Independent Processes Simulation
The applications of simulating independent computer processes span various domains, industries, and use cases, reflecting its versatility, applicability, and significance in modern computing landscapes. In data-intensive applications for example big data processing, analytics, and machine learning, simulating independent processes enables distributed computing frameworks, enabling efficient data partitioning, parallel processing, and scalable data analysis. Similarly, in cloud computing environments, simulating independent processes allows for workload distribution, resource provisioning, and service orchestration, ensuring optimal performance, scalability, and cost-efficiency. Additionally, in real-time systems, simulations, and simulations, simulating independent processes enables efficient task scheduling, event handling, and system synchronization, ensuring responsiveness, predictability, and reliability in mission-critical applications and scenarios.

Best Practices for Simulating Independent Processes
While simulating independent computer processes offers significant advantages and applications, adhering to best practices is vital to be certain efficiency, performance, and reliability within computing environments. Firstly, developers should adopt modular design principles, encapsulating independent processes within distinct modules, components, or services to facilitate isolation, encapsulation, and reuse. Secondly, developers should implement robust concurrency control mechanisms, such as locks, semaphores, and monitors, to manage access, synchronization, and coordination between independent processes effectively. Aside from that, developers should leverage monitoring, logging, and profiling tools to observe system performance, diagnose bottlenecks, and optimize resource utilization, ensuring scalability, responsiveness, and efficiency in dynamic computing environments.

Simulating independent computer processes stands as a fundamental technique that allows efficient multitasking, enhanced performance, and optimized resource utilization within modern computing ecosystems. By comprehending the advantages, applications, and best practices linked to simulating independent processes, developers, engineers, and users can leverage its capabilities to navigate the complexities of contemporary computing landscapes effectively. As the digital landscape continues to evolve, the capability to simulate independent processes remains paramount, fostering innovation, scalability, and efficiency across diverse domains, industries, and use cases. By embracing the opportunities presented by simulating independent processes and adhering to best practices, individuals and organizations can unlock their full potential, achieve desired outcomes, and thrive within the interconnected world of modern computing.